The Influence of Humidity on Paint Drying Time



You're probably questioning just how the humidity outside can affect your painting task, well let me inform you, it can actually reduce the drying time of your paint!

When the air is moist, it is filled with moisture, and this can trigger your paint to take a lot longer to completely dry than it would certainly in a drier setting. This is since the water in the paint needs to evaporate in order for the paint to completely dry, and when the air is currently full of moisture, it can't take in any more, which slows down the drying process.

The effect of moisture on your paint task can be even more considerable if you are painting in an inadequately ventilated location, as the wetness in the air will certainly have nowhere to go, and will simply remain around your project, making the drying time even longer.

The very best method to fight the effects of humidity on your painting job is to select a day when the weather is completely dry, or to repaint throughout a time of day when the moisture is lower, such as early in the morning or later in the evening. Additionally, you can make use of a dehumidifier or a follower to assist circulate the air and speed up the drying time.

Tips for Picking the most effective Weather for Your Home Painting Task



Ideal painting problems require careful consideration of aspects such as temperature, humidity, and wind speed to guarantee a smooth and also end up. When planning your home painting task, it's important to select the very best weather conditions to stay clear of any problems or delays.

Here are some ideas to help you select the appropriate weather conditions for your painting job:



- Examine the weather report: Before starting your task, see to it to inspect the weather forecast for the following few days. Avoid painting on days with high humidity or strong winds, as these conditions can impact the paint's adhesion and drying out time.

- Go for modest temperatures: Severe temperatures can affect the uniformity of the paint and cause it to completely dry too promptly or not in any way. Aim for temperature levels in between 50 and 85 degrees Fahrenheit for ideal paint conditions.

- Prevent straight sunlight: Painting in straight sunlight can create the paint to completely dry too swiftly, resulting in uneven insurance coverage and blistering. Pick a day with partial shade or wait up until the sunlight has overlooked your house.

- Consider the time of day: Paint in the late afternoon or early evening can be a great alternative as the temperature and moisture degrees have a tendency to be reduced. However, see to it to end up painting prior to it obtains as well dark to prevent any type of blunders.

By taking these factors right into consideration, you can guarantee that your residence paint job is a success, with a smooth and also complete that will certainly last for many years to find.
